Understanding How Nizatidine Helps Your Child

Nizatidine is a competitive histamine H2 receptor antagonist that selectively blocks histamine-induced activation of adenylate cyclase in gastric parietal cells. By decreasing intracellular cAMP, it lowers basal and nocturnal gastric acid secretion and reduces pepsin output.
